Proposed Colorado bank nears 60% of fundraising goal

A proposed bank in Avon, Colo., continues to make progress on its fundraising goal.

Battle Financial disclosed on LinkedIn that it brought in $1.8 million by issuing convertible debt in January. Organizers have now raised nearly $8.8 million, nearing 60% of their goal.

The group first applied for deposit insurance in March 2022, outlining a plan that included dealing in precious metals and offering deposit swap services to registered investment advisers. Frank Trotter, a former founder of Everbank, would service as the proposed bank’s president.

Battle Financial received conditional approval from the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ency in late 2022.
